The problem (ground it in real logs FIRST) + +lasuite-drive's `setup_custom_tests` wires OIDC by doing a **full 12-service `abra app deploy --chaos` +redeploy** of an already-running heavy stack. That reconverge is **flaky**: a collabora reconverge +race + a **transient backend gunicorn-perms / WOPI-404 window**. Only **backend/app** consume the +OIDC env, so re-converging collabora/onlyoffice/minio/db is unnecessary exposure. The Builder +correctly did NOT claim Q3.2 (a flaky setup isn't a reliable green) and filed this. + +**Step 0 (do before fixing):** capture the actual failure from a flaky run — collabora WOPI-discovery +timing, the backend log at the 404, and the exact gunicorn perms error — so we fix the real root +cause, not a guess. On a branch of the +lasuite-drive recipe (recipe-maintainer): + +1. **Order backend behind collabora's WOPI readiness.** Add a Docker **healthcheck on collabora** + (WOPI discovery endpoint → 200) and make backend **wait for it / retry WOPI discovery with + backoff** instead of failing during collabora startup. Turns the race into deterministic ordering. +2. **Fix the gunicorn-perms race.** The transient perms error is a volume-permission race at startup + (gunicorn can't read/write a mount until perms are set). Fix in the entrypoint: set perms before + exec'ing gunicorn (or a proper init step). +3. **Make OIDC discovery lazy / retrying.** If backend validates the OIDC provider eagerly at boot + and dies when it's briefly unreachable, that's what forces the deploy-with-dep dance. Resolve OIDC + discovery lazily (at first login, with retry) so the app boots without the provider up.
